Ep 247: Society Is Too Damn Sensitive…

Navigating the need for personal time as parents can be challenging, especially when children are unable to grasp the concept of privacy. Have you ever had to negotiate with your kids to secure some intimate moments with your partner?

What strategies do you employ to keep your children occupied and ensure a bit of seclusion? During our “pillow talk” segment, we explored whether parents should continue to provide a permanent space for their children as they grow older.

At what age do you feel they might have overstayed their welcome? Additionally, does your childs gender affect your parenting style?

Let’s talk about it…🗣️🗣️🗣️.
